Analysis: Jim Flaherty's sacred cows — corporate tax cuts

OTTAWA–Faced with skyrocketing debts, the federal Conservatives say they will begin cutting spending on government programs in the March 4 budget. But the massive corporate tax cuts that are deepening Ottawa's deficit hole every year will not be touched, officials say.

Tightened mortgage rules could slow home sales

OTTAWA — Finance Minister Jim Flaherty tightened mortgage rules on Tuesday and, in doing so, may have taken the steam out of a housing market that had seen prices and sales activity rise rapidly over the last year.

Mortgage demand drives bonds

They were the biggest issuance in the Canadian marketplace last year. But there were no media headlines or industry buzz. The tried-and-true Canada Mortgage Bonds (CMB) churned out through a trust set up by the Canada Mortgage and Housing Corp. have been so much part of the landscape that their growth goes almost unnoticed.
